Transaction 7d5abb32da14a850fc17aff69ecfc9b69a2278d8dc173cf44589d1bebcd1cb12
1 Input
1 Output
-
7d5abb32da14a850fc17aff69ecfc9b69a2278d8dc173cf44589d1bebcd1cb12:0
- value
- 179546689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7aa57e77d35b72b0375a2cb5861b7307e4bbb65e OP_EQUAL
- address
- MK5evZPmhDXwNgrQYGSFKkrxoX17mUpHpX